June 2011: Trail to Black Creek; Caboose
Info
Things are pretty quiet on the GB&W since my last report. The
trail from Green Bay does indeed end in Black Creek and has not crossed
State Highway 47. I am a little disappointed in the condition of the trail
though. When I inspected it last fall, there appears to be an insufficient
amount of ballast laid down on the trail as you can see cracks on the
trail bed where rain has washed small amounts of dirt away. Maybe someday
they will upgrade it better as it becomes more popular with trail users.
Other trails on the GB&W seem to be in good condition including the
one from Amherst Junction that goes under Highway 10.
And there is an update to the caboose roster for the GB&W. Caboose
number 115 that I see countless times in the CN yard off Whitman Street in
Appleton appears to be in its' new home. It gets moved in and out of the
yard as they do track work and other projects in and around Appleton.
